Benzene, C6H6 is miscible with hexane (C6H14) but iron (IIl) nitrate, and Sulfuric acid, H2SO4Fe(NO3)3 are not miscible with hexane (C6H14)
Since organic or non polar dissolves in nom polar solvent.here both benzene and hexane (C6H14) are non polar solvents.But iron (IIl) nitrate, Fe(NO3)3 and Sulfuric acid, H2SO4 are inorganic and polar, therefore cannot dissolve with non polar solvent like hexane.

Stirring a pot with a metal spoon thereby making the spoon hot in the hand is a mode of heat transfer called conduction.
Heat is form of energy that causes differences in temperature between two bodies.
- There are three modes of heat transfer which are conduction, convection and radiation.
- Radiation is a form of heat transfer that does not involve a material medium.
- Convection is heat transfer in fluids that involves movement of the materials of the medium.
